How much do delivery associate j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 9, 2026, the average hourly pay for delivery associate in Pullman, WA is $17.41,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.96 and $18.56 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are some common challenges faced by delivery associates, and how can they be overcome?

Delivery Associates often encounter challenges such as navigating unfamiliar routes, managing time constraints to meet delivery windows, and handling difficult weather conditions. To overcome these, it's helpful to use up-to-date GPS technology, plan routes in advance, and maintain clear communication with dispatch and customers. Additionally, staying organized and keeping a positive attitude can make the job smoother and more enjoyable.

What is the difference between Delivery Associate vs Delivery Driver?

AspectDelivery AssociateDelivery Driver
Required CredentialsDriver's license, background check, possibly a clean driving recordDriver's license, vehicle registration, background check
Work EnvironmentMostly on foot or using a scooter/bike in urban areasDriving a company or personal vehicle over various routes
Employer & Industry UsageCommonly used by food delivery, e-commerce, and courier companiesUsed by logistics, courier, and food delivery services

Both roles involve delivering goods, but Delivery Associates typically work on foot or with small vehicles in urban settings, focusing on last-mile delivery. Delivery Drivers usually operate larger vehicles over longer distances. The roles share similar credentials and are used across similar industries, but their work environments and daily tasks differ.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a delivery associate,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Delivery Associate, you need a valid driver’s license, strong navigation skills, and basic physical fitness to handle packages. Familiarity with GPS devices, delivery management apps, and handheld scanners is typically required. Reliability, excellent time management, and strong customer service skills help you stand out in this role. These abilities are crucial for ensuring timely, accurate deliveries and maintaining high customer satisfaction.

What is a delivery associate?

Delivery Associates are professionals responsible for transporting packages, goods, or products from a distribution center or store directly to customers or businesses. They typically drive a delivery vehicle, follow assigned routes, and ensure timely and accurate deliveries. In addition to delivering items, Delivery Associates may also handle package scanning, customer interactions, and maintaining delivery records. Their role is essential in the supply chain, particularly for e-commerce and retail companies.

Ferguson is currently seeking an entry level Warehouse Associate to join our team!

Hours are Monday to Friday 6:00 a.m. to 3:00 p.m. (Some flexibility may be available in hours)

Responsibilities

Safely operate a stand-up forklift (order selector/cherry picker) to pull and prepare outbound customer orders.

Build, wrap, sort, and transport pallets and packages.

Use technology like RF devices to sort, scan, and prepare orders.

Accurately and timely receive, verify, stage and stock all incoming material.

Clean the workspace as you go and participate with the team in keeping our facility clean, safe, and accident free.

Must adhere to all safety regulations, including the correct usage of personal protective equipment (PPE). This includes wearing a safety harness with a maximum weight capacity of 400 lbs.

May b e responsible for providing driver duties and responsibilities

Qualifications

Must be at least 21 years of age

Must have a valid state issued license

Follow all DOT standards and regulations

Possession of a DOT Medical Card or the ability to acquire a DOT Medical Card

0-3 years warehouse experience in shipping, receiving, delivery, or inventory management is preferred.

High attention to detail.

Comfortable in a fast paced, changing environment.

Positive demeanor, dependability, and strong work ethic.

Self-starter with ability to learn our systems quickly.

Continued focus on improving system efficiencies and business practices.

Ability to lift items that weigh up to 75 lbs regularly.

Knowledge of safety regulations and procedures.

Pre-employment drug and background screening required
